Why Are Tungsten Carbide Rods Preferred for Cutting Tools and Machining Operations?


In the realm of precision engineering, where every micron matters, tungsten carbide rods stand as paragons of durability and performance. These unassuming cylindrical components have become indispensable in modern machining operations, outshining traditional materials with their unparalleled resilience. But what makes them so revered? Let’s delve into the intricacies that elevate tungsten carbide rods to their esteemed position.

Unyielding Hardness Meets Exceptional Wear Resistance
Tungsten carbide is not merely hard—it is Herculean in its resistance to deformation. With a hardness rating surpassing that of many steels, it effortlessly slices through even the most obstinate materials. This extraordinary tenacity ensures that tools crafted from tungsten carbide rods retain their cutting edge far longer than alternatives. Consequently, manufacturers experience reduced downtime and fewer tool replacements, translating into significant cost savings.

Moreover, wear resistance is where tungsten carbide truly shines. The material’s microstructure, composed of fine tungsten carbide particles bound by a metallic matrix, creates an impervious barrier against abrasion. Whether carving through titanium alloys or shaping composite materials, these rods exhibit steadfast endurance, ensuring consistent performance under duress.

Thermal Stability: A Game-Changing Attribute
Machining generates heat—often intense and relentless. Traditional tool materials falter under such thermal stress, leading to premature failure or diminished accuracy. Tungsten carbide rods, however, possess remarkable thermal stability. They withstand elevated temperatures without compromising structural integrity or dimensional precision.

This attribute proves invaluable in high-speed machining applications, where friction-induced heat could otherwise degrade tool performance. By maintaining their form and function, tungsten carbide rods enable uninterrupted productivity, even in the most demanding environments.

Versatility Across Industries
From aerospace to automotive, and from medical device manufacturing to woodworking, tungsten carbide rods find application across a spectrum of industries. Their adaptability stems from their ability to be tailored for specific tasks. For instance, varying cobalt content within the metallic binder can adjust the rod's toughness or hardness, catering to unique operational requirements.

Furthermore, their compatibility with advanced coatings enhances their utility. Diamond-like carbon (DLC) or titanium nitride coatings can further augment their already impressive properties, making them suitable for ultra-precision tasks. Such versatility ensures that no matter the challenge, tungsten carbide rods rise to the occasion.

Cost Efficiency Through Longevity
While the initial investment in tungsten carbide rods may exceed that of conventional tool materials, their longevity renders them a prudent financial choice. The extended lifespan of tools fabricated from these rods reduces the frequency of replacements, thereby minimizing operational disruptions. Additionally, their superior performance often results in faster machining speeds and higher-quality finishes, amplifying overall efficiency.

Consider this: a single tungsten carbide rod can outlast multiple iterations of standard steel tools. Over time, the cumulative savings on material costs and labor hours become substantial, making it a compelling proposition for businesses aiming to optimize their bottom line.

Environmental Considerations
In an era increasingly defined by sustainability, tungsten carbide rods offer an eco-conscious advantage. Their extended service life means less frequent disposal of worn-out tools, reducing industrial waste. Furthermore, advancements in recycling technologies allow for the reclamation of tungsten carbide, fostering a circular economy. By choosing these rods, industries not only enhance their operational prowess but also contribute to environmental stewardship.
